A stute’s Nuclear team is partnering with our client a leading contractor specialising in civil engineering within major infrastructure sectors, including nuclear, highways, and large-scale projects. With a strong focus on safety, quality, and sustainability, they are committed to delivering complex engineering solutions that support the UK's infrastructure growth. We are looking to recruit a Site Agent for its Sizewell C site. The Site Agent role is vital for ensuring the successful delivery of this exciting project and comes with a salary up to £63,000, car allowance and private health care. If you’re a Site Agent or Senior Agent and are looking to work for a dynamic and progressive organisation, then submit your CV to apply today.                 Responsibilities and duties Reporting to the Contracts Manager you will:  
  • Lead the delivery of projects, ensuring they meet safety, quality, program, and financial targets.
  • Build and maintain strong relationships with clients, stakeholders, and subcontractors to ensure successful project execution.
  • Oversee the production of detailed construction programmes, monitoring progress and ensuring timely delivery of critical activities.
  • Manage project risks, costs, and resources while ensuring compliance with health, safety, and environmental standards.
  • Develop and support the project team, ensuring all members understand their responsibilities and are aligned with the project objectives.
  • Monitor and manage project changes, providing clear communication on the impact of changes to cost and time.
  • Prepare regular reports on project progress, highlighting risks, issues, and milestones to both internal and client teams.
Professional qualifications We are looking for someone with the following:  
  • Proven leadership and management skills within civil engineering projects.
  • Strong understanding of the CDM Regulations and experience in implementing health, safety, and environmental procedures.
  • Experience producing and managing Work Package Plans, Task Briefing Sheets, and cost plans.
  • Excellent communication skills and the ability to build relationships with both internal and external stakeholders.
Personal skills The Site Agent role would suit someone who is:  
  • A strong leader with excellent problem-solving abilities.
  • Organized, with the ability to manage multiple priorities and meet tight deadlines.
  • Self-motivated and proactive, with the ability to take initiative.
Salary and benefits of the Site Agent role  
  • Salary between £53,000 and £63,000
  • Car or car allowance
  • Bonus
  • Private Health Care
  • Life Insurance
